Exibits and Gallaries edit

Part of what makes this a stub is the exibits and gallaries aren't listed. These are the perminant exibits are:
Union Station Gallery (Through These Doors: The History of Omaha's Union Station)
Baright Home and Family Gallery (area homes through the years including the tipee)
Bishop Clarkson Community Gallery (omaha history such as wowt, coming to omaha, etc)
Byron Reed Gallery of Coins and Documents (already in article under collections)
Fraser Stryker Trans-Mississippi Exposition Gallery (1898 exposition, fake arch area)
Trish and Dick Davidson Gallery (the tracks icluding the stores)
Omaha at Work Gallery (i think this is the area with lewis and clark)
